YHX 400G is a 1969 MG C GT in Green with a 2,912c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 21 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 61.9%.

Across all 1969 MG C GT models, the average MOT pass rate is 80.7% with a typical mileage of 31,721 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a MG C GT f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 108 recorded failures. If you're considering buying YHX 400G,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The MG C GT typically stays on UK roads for around 58 years. At 57 years old, this MG C GT is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
